These are great Photos Ed. Any chance on sharing what you do in your pp? This is my favorite look but I don’t know where to start or even know what this look is called so I can look it up. Thanks.


Thanks. There really isn't a magic formula, it is mostly experience and maybe because of my experience processing film I was able to translate that to LR and PS. I shoot in raw and usually the first thing I do is adjust highlights, shadows, blacks, and whites after that I adjust other settings till I get the desired effect and then add a slight vignette.
